Listing of Color Additives Exempt From Certification; Astaxanthin Dimethyldisuccinate; Confirmation of Effective Date
Document Number: 2010-2522
Type: Rule
Date: 2010-02-05
Agency: Food and Drug Administration, Department of Health and Human Services
The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) is confirming the effective date of December 8, 2009, for the final rule that appeared in the Federal Register of November 5, 2009. The final rule amended the color additive regulations to provide for the safe use of astaxanthin dimethyldisuccinate as a color additive in the feed of salmonid fish to enhance the color of their flesh.
Listing of Color Additives Exempt From Certification; Paracoccus Pigment; Confirmation of Effective Date
Document Number: 2010-2521
Type: Rule
Date: 2010-02-05
Agency: Food and Drug Administration, Department of Health and Human Services
The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) is confirming the effective date of December 17, 2009, for the final rule that appeared in the Federal Register of November 16, 2009. The final rule amended the color additive regulations to provide for the safe use of paracoccus pigment as a color additive in the feed of salmonid fish to enhance the color of their flesh.

New Animal Drugs for Use in Animal Feeds; Ractopamine; Monensin
Document Number: 2010-2427
Type: Rule
Date: 2010-02-05
Agency: Food and Drug Administration, Department of Health and Human Services
The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) is amending the animal drug regulations to reflect approval of an original new animal drug application (NADA) filed by Elanco Animal Health, A Division of Eli Lilly & Co. The NADA provides for use of single-ingredient Type A medicated articles containing ractopamine hydrochloride and monensin to formulate two-way combination Type C medicated feeds for finishing hen and tom turkeys.
